Recycled water: Regulatory framework and permitted agricultural uses, in Victoria

Recycled or reclaimed water should be an important resource in a country as dry as Australia. Regrettably, it is an under-utilised resource, largely because of misunderstandings by consumers, producers and governments. There are huge opportunities to use the latest modern technologies for treatments and applications for wastewater, and broadening the scope for many usages in agriculture and in food production.
